THOMASVILLE, Ga. — The job fair to be conducted by a new industry has been rescheduled for late June.
Check-Mate Manufacturing will conduct a job fair from 10 a.m. to 5 p.m., Saturday, June 22, at Building A, Room 132, at Southern Regional Technical College.
“We’re looking to hire about 50 people to begin with. Over the next five years, we will be growing the business and hire more than 230,” said Naomi Stifler, company human resources director, who is recruiting in Thomasville.
Those attending the job fair should bring a resume.
“We’ll have about six people working that,” Stifler said.
Applicants must have earned a high school diploma or GED and have manufacturing backgrounds in production, quality, shipping and receiving, assembly and maintenance.
Georgia Department of Labor representatives will screen resumes for qualifications and assess skills. Those with desired skills and qualifications will be interviewed later via phone by Department of Labor employees.
Production will begin in August at the former Caterpillar building on the west bypass. The company manufactures firearm magazines and medical tools, among other products.
Stifler said the local labor department office has received 100 to 125 resumes submitted for Check-Mate Manufacturing jobs.
“I’ve been screening them for the last couple of weeks,” Stifler said.
All resumes submitted at the job fair, at the labor department and on the company’s website will be reviewed.
